How to Remove the Headlight Connector of the Cruze?

6Answers
VanFrancisco
07/29/2025, 04:42:18 PM

Method for removing the headlight connector of the Cruze: Remove the small storage compartment below the headlight switch, then push out the headlight switch from inside by hand to expose the headlight switch wiring harness. There is a latch on the wiring harness connector for securing it. Use an appropriate tool to pull the latch outward a few millimeters, press down on the wiring harness connector lock pin, and then unplug the wiring harness connector. Taking the Cruze 2018 320 Manual Pioneer Edition as an example: It is a compact car launched by SAIC-GM Chevrolet, with dimensions of 4666mm in length, 1807mm in width, and 1460mm in height, and a wheelbase of 2700mm. It is equipped with a 1.5L naturally aspirated engine, delivering a maximum power of 84kw and a maximum torque of 146nm, paired with a 6-speed manual transmission.

VioletRose
08/14/2025, 02:01:02 PM

I've removed the Cruze headlight connector several times. First, make sure the car is turned off and the power is cut before starting. Open the hood and locate the back of the headlight assembly. There's a noticeable plastic clip on the side of that black square connector. Press the raised button in the center of the clip with your thumb, while using your index finger to hook the connector housing and gently pull it outward—it should come right off. Never yank the wiring harness with brute force, as it can easily break the wires. Last time, I encountered a connector that was stuck particularly tight and found that dust had accumulated in the clip groove. I sprayed a bit of WD-40 lubricant, waited five minutes, and then pressed again—it loosened right up. After removal, remember to check the metal contacts inside the connector for any black oxidation, as this can affect conductivity. The whole process doesn't require tools, but wear gloves to prevent cuts from surrounding metal parts.

DianaFitz
10/16/2025, 02:02:16 AM

Last time I changed the bulb myself, I removed this connector—it was quite straightforward. First, release the hood latch, then locate the wired connector at the back of the headlight. Remember to press down the spring clip on top before pulling it out. I noticed that some older Cruze models have side-sliding clips, where you need to use your fingernail to push the small slider sideways. Keep your hands steady during removal to avoid bending the pins. A quick tip: if you're replacing the bulb too, wear cotton gloves to prevent fingerprints on the glass, which can affect heat dissipation. The whole process takes just three minutes, but never attempt it when the engine is still hot—once, I got blisters on my wrist from touching a radiator pipe. When reinstalling, listen for the 'click' to ensure it's securely fastened.

AngelinaMarie
11/29/2025, 01:49:30 AM

Before unplugging, turn off the light switch and disconnect the negative battery terminal. Locate the wired connector behind the headlight, and carefully observe the locking mechanism before proceeding. Most Cruze connectors are push-pull types—simply press the top button with your thumb and pull straight out. For models with a waterproof rubber ring at the bottom, pinch the edge of the ring before releasing the latch. It's best to use a phone light for illumination during the process to avoid accidentally touching the fuse box wiring. When installing the new bulb, pay attention to the polarity—installing it backward will prevent the light from turning on. Finally, always test the lights before closing the hood.

DeGabriela
01/19/2026, 03:13:13 AM

Prepare a flashlight and gloves before starting the disassembly. The Cruze headlight connector is located inside the wheel arch, requiring you to bend down to operate. Press the elastic latch on the square plastic head until you hear a light click, indicating the clip is released. If you encounter a stubborn old connector, you can use a thin plastic sheet to assist in prying by inserting it into the gap. I always make it a habit to take a photo to document the wire sequence, avoiding mistakes during reinstallation. After removal, check if the copper pins are corroded with green rust from moisture; if so, use electronic cleaner to treat them. Finally, it's recommended to apply a bit of silicone grease in the slot to prevent dust, which can extend the service life.

DelKiara
04/15/2026, 04:17:19 AM

As a modification enthusiast, I frequently remove these types of connectors. The Cruze commonly uses HB3 and 9006 specifications, with slight differences in the clip positions. The key operation is to press the top release button with one hand while pulling the connector out parallelly. If it's hard to remove, try gently wiggling it left and right while pressing. When retrofitting xenon lights, you can directly install the ballast wiring harness at this connector, but make sure the waterproof sleeve is properly repositioned. By the way, after unplugging, remember to protect the exposed wire ends with heat shrink tubing—last time I didn't cover them well, causing a short circuit in the rain that blew the fuse. The whole process can be done in just five minutes when the car is cold.

How Many Types of Differential Locks Are There?

Automotive differential locks mainly include the following types: 1. Open Differential. The open differential allows the left and right wheels to rotate at different speeds when the car turns. 2. Multi-plate Clutch Limited Slip Differential. It is equipped with a clutch, consisting of several friction plates and steel plates. The friction plates are clamped to the rotating shaft, while the steel plates are clamped to the axle housing. 3. Torsen Differential. The core of the Torsen differential is the worm gear and worm wheel meshing system. Due to its fast response speed, the Torsen differential is widely used in central differentials and inter-wheel differentials in many vehicles. 4. Viscous Coupling Differential. It does not require driver intervention and can automatically distribute power to the rear drive axle as needed.

What Causes Cold Start Shaking?

Causes of car cold start shaking mainly include: 1. Improper air-fuel mixture. The air-fuel mixture ratio is inaccurately adjusted, occurring in both open-loop and closed-loop control systems. In vehicles with closed-loop control, the oxygen sensor's minimum operating temperature is 370 degrees Celsius. 2. Carbon deposits on valves and intake ports. If carbon deposits form on the valves and intake ports inside the engine, they can absorb a certain amount of fuel, causing the ECU to make incorrect judgments. 3. Uneven cylinder conditions. After prolonged use of the engine, the gap between each cylinder liner and piston can vary in size—some gaps are larger, while others are smaller. During a cold start, without proper oil lubrication, larger gaps in the cylinders can allow leakage of high-temperature gases, reducing power output. 4. Faulty coolant temperature sensor. The coolant temperature sensor is one of the key inputs for the ECU to determine the engine's operating condition. If the engine is cold-starting at -10 degrees Celsius, but the sensor "tells the ECU the temperature is 20 degrees Celsius," the ECU will inject fuel based on a 20-degree condition. Naturally, the fuel amount will be insufficient, leading to shaking.

What are the body dimensions of the Audi S3?

The body length of the Audi S3 is 4504mm, the width is 1816mm, and the height is 1415mm, as per official data. The length of the Audi S3 refers to the distance between two vertical planes perpendicular to the vehicle's longitudinal symmetry plane and touching the outermost protruding points at the front and rear of the car. The width refers to the distance between two planes parallel to the vehicle's longitudinal symmetry plane and touching the outermost rigid fixed protruding points on both sides of the vehicle. The height refers to the distance between the highest point of the vehicle and the supporting plane. The Audi S3 is equipped with a 2.0T turbocharged engine and a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ission, delivering a maximum power of 228 kW at 5450 to 6500 rpm and a maximum torque of 400 Nm at 2000 to 5450 rpm. There are national regulations regarding vehicle dimensions. According to the national standard "GB1589-89," the total width of a vehicle does not include side mirrors. The limitation on vehicle width is intended to provide sufficient lateral clearance for overtaking between adjacent lanes. This means that, under national standards, the significance of vehicle width data lies in ensuring enough space during overtaking, preventing accidents due to excessive width or situations where road markings are narrower than the vehicle's width. Additionally, national regulations stipulate that the total width of a vehicle must not exceed 2.5m to meet the requirements of public road usage.

Is a tire pressure of 2.6 bar suitable for highway driving?

Tire pressure of 2.6 bar is suitable for highway driving. For household cars, maintaining tire pressure between 2.3 bar and 2.5 bar is normal for highway driving, but this is only a theoretical value. The specific tire pressure should be determined based on the car's usage conditions. Additional information: 1. Car tires are a very important part of the driving process, being the only component in contact with the ground. During driving, it is essential to regularly check the condition of the tires. With the continuous development of automotive production technology, cars are now equipped with tire pressure monitoring or warning functions. While driving, the working status of the tires can be observed at any time through the car's dashboard. 2. Under normal driving conditions, both high and low tire pressure can affect the car's performance. Excessive tire pressure wears out the middle part of the tread, while insufficient tire pressure causes wear on both sides of the tire. Therefore, only by maintaining an appropriate tire pressure range can the tires wear evenly and function properly.

How to reset the tire pressure light on a Golf?

Golf tire pressure light reset button is located on the gear lever panel. Press and hold the SET button on the gear lever for 3 to 5 seconds until you hear a beep sound, indicating the tire pressure reset is complete. The tire pressure warning light on the dashboard will then disappear automatically. The Golf tire pressure reset button is the tire pressure monitoring indicator button located at the lower part of the central auxiliary instrument panel. There are two types of tire monitoring indicator calibrations: Type A and Type B. For the Golf tire monitoring indicator (Type B), recalibration is required after changing tire pressure or replacing one or more wheels. Wheel rotation (e.g., front-to-rear rotation) also requires recalibration of the tire monitoring indicator.
